Compared to the U.S.
The mean occupational therapy aides salary in Tennessee is $31,980, about 27.5% below the U.S. average ($44,110). That works out to roughly $15/hr at 2,080 hours per year.

How much do occupational therapy aides make in Tennessee?
The median occupational therapy aides salary in Tennessee is $27,840 per year (mean $31,980), and about 80% earn between $25,700 and $40,090.
How much do occupational therapy aides make per hour in Tennessee?
Roughly $15 per hour, based on a mean annual wage of $31,980 and 2,080 work hours per year.
Is Tennessee a high-paying state for occupational therapy aides?
Tennessee ranks #26 of 27 states for occupational therapy aides pay. Its mean salary of $31,980 is about 27.5% below the U.S. average of $44,110.
